Technical SEO for online reputation management
Online reputation management depends on more than content and communications. An executive biography, correction page, company resource, or crisis update cannot support visibility if it is blocked, duplicated, rendered poorly, buried in the architecture, or linked inconsistently.
Elena audits the technical foundation behind those assets. Her work includes crawlability, indexation, rendering, redirects, canonicals, sitemaps, internal linking, structured data, JavaScript SEO, and page experience. She translates findings into priorities that developers, marketers, writers, and communications teams can implement and verify.

Web performance and Core Web Vitals
Slow loading, delayed interaction, and unstable layouts create friction when users are deciding whether to trust a person or organization. Elena reviews Largest Contentful Paint, Interaction to Next Paint, and Cumulative Layout Shift alongside server response, the critical rendering path, CSS and JavaScript delivery, image handling, fonts, and third-party scripts.
The goal is not a cosmetic score. It is a stable, accessible, maintainable page that communicates essential information quickly across devices and network conditions.
Site architecture, entities, and structured data
Clear relationships between company, service, location, leadership, case-study, policy, and crisis pages help users and search systems understand an organization. Elena reviews architecture and internal linking so strategically important pages are not isolated or forced to compete with near-duplicates.
She also advises on accurate organization, person, service, article, FAQ, and breadcrumb markup. Structured data can clarify entities and page types, but it does not guarantee rankings, rich results, citations, or favorable treatment.
GEO and AI-assisted discovery
Elena's Generative Engine Optimization work focuses on entity clarity, source consistency, authorship, evidence labeling, page structure, and topical relationships. These practices can make content easier for search and answer systems to interpret.
No technical method can guarantee inclusion or a favorable AI-generated answer. The defensible approach is to publish accurate material, identify authors and sources, maintain consistent entities, and keep the information architecture technically accessible.

Frequently asked questions
What does a technical SEO specialist contribute to ORM?
A technical SEO specialist identifies crawling, indexing, rendering, architecture, duplication, performance, and structured-data issues that can prevent accurate reputation assets from being discovered and understood.
Can technical SEO remove a negative search result?
No. Technical SEO can improve eligible owned assets and correct problems on sites the client controls. It cannot force a publisher, platform, court, or search engine to remove or rerank third-party material.
Why do Core Web Vitals matter for reputation pages?
Fast, responsive, visually stable pages reduce friction when users are evaluating a person or organization. Core Web Vitals are one part of a broader experience and technical-quality assessment.
